Output 27d66e6e30213ed2cc06703bff027e997bd22fe57ddfbafc5891d67a59513fe7:0

value
9216638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9a66aadcd78db337a92965ef1491ee7c76d3f1a OP_EQUAL
address
3HA3UoJXRNXpwrhyHSqFcCAxSJseFqbTbz
transaction
27d66e6e30213ed2cc06703bff027e997bd22fe57ddfbafc5891d67a59513fe7